A: The rebalancer optimizes for predicted demand two hours ahead, not current fill levels. A station at 85% now may be forecast to empty during the evening commute, so the solver front-loads inventory. If the forecast model is stale (ingest lag over 30 minutes), proposals can look wrong; check the model timestamp in the dashboard first. Known issue: the Harbor Loop cluster over-forecasts on weekends; a fix is in review. Questions for the team go here.

escalation mailbox, bafog-fafog: ulador@paliqlabs.internal

MEMO — For the Incoming Director

Welcome aboard. Before your first week, please review the planned 8% price increase for legacy Orvane Suite customers, effective next quarter. Grandfathered accounts from the Maple Hollow acquisition require careful handling, and Priya Lenhart has drafted migration terms. The rationale is sensitive and not yet shared with staff. The confidential summary follows below.

internal memo for hafog-hadug: The pricing group signed off on a budget of $16.1 million for Project Gorir. The renewal with Oliionax Systems closes at $14.1 million a year, 46 percent above the last contract.

**09:42** — Heads up, support folks: the Burrowbase schema migration ran with the dual-write shim, so nothing went down, but a few customers saw stale profile fields for ~6 minutes while the backfill caught up. All reads are consistent now. If tickets reference that window, tag them to the build noted below.

session token of kafof-kafop = htk31_c3becf8b8eac3ed970037fba36e258e